Manchester United are on the verge of completing the signature of Royal Antwerp goalkeeper Senne Ranmens for a fee of around 20 million euros.
Catch off side I have consulted several sources near the deal and it appears that Man Utd is trapped in an agreement with Antwerp.
Red Devils initially bids in Lammens’ Euro 17 million region, but further consultations have improved the overall package to nearly 20 million euros.
“A complete agreement is within reach right now,” one source said. This was confirmed by another person who said, “United is on the verge of securing this contract. The negotiations have entered the final stretch.”

This summer, United signed an all-new Front 3.
The new “keeper” will be a good addition to Reuben Amorim’s team. This has been a struggle at the beginning of this season.
Mufc lost to Arsenal on the first day of the season, then painted alongside Fulham and was knocked out of the Carabao Cup last night by League 2 side Grimsby.
These new signatures will need to be delivered, or Amorim will soon face serious pressure.
